THE CATHARINE MARY SCOTT-SMITH WILL TRUST
Financial health, per its FY2023 accounts
The accounts state that the trust holds net assets of £911,135, comprising UK investments with a market value of £1,894,164 and cash of £122,767, offset by creditors of £919,409. The trust generated a net income of £214,850 from investment returns, after deducting expenses of £19,780 and a loss on sale of investments of £32,930. Undistributed income carried forward increased to £915,129 following distributions of £95,703 made during the year.
